Person dies after gang members clash in Northcote

Last updated: February 26, 2026 12:10 am
Share
Person dies after gang members clash in Northcote
SHARE
A tragic incident involving gang members in Christchurch has resulted in the loss of one life, as confirmed by the police. Officers responded to a call at an address on Hoani St in Northcote, where four individuals were injured, one critically, on February 18 around 9.30pm.

Detective Inspector Nicola Reeves from Christchurch expressed condolences to the family of the deceased individual and assured them of ongoing support during this challenging time. The incident, which reportedly involved rival gangs Black Power and the Mongrel Mob, may have included gunfire.

While acknowledging the gang affiliations of those involved, Det Insp Reeves clarified that the incident was not gang-related but rather an isolated conflict between specific individuals. She emphasized a zero-tolerance policy towards any form of retaliation and assured the public of their safety.

Three individuals, aged 19, 31, and 40, have been arrested and charged with aggravated wounding and robbery. Det Insp Reeves mentioned that additional charges are being considered, and the suspects are currently in custody, scheduled to appear in court on March 17.

Despite the gravity of the situation, there is no ongoing threat to the wider community. Police presence remains vigilant, working in collaboration with specialized units and community partners to ensure public safety.
